Music Venues

Asked by Siân BerryGreen PartyDepartment for Culture, Media and SportTabled Answered 28 November 2024UIN 901518

The question

To ask the Secretary of State for Culture, Media and Sport, what steps she is taking to help support grassroots music venues.

Answered by Chris Bryant

The Government response to the Culture, Media and Sport Committee's report on grassroots music venues outlines our commitment to working across the live music sector to support grassroots music.

We urge the live music industry to introduce a voluntary ticket levy for stadium and arena shows, to support a sustainable grassroots music sector. I am writing to the major players in the industry to underline the importance of swift progress, and on the need to unblock any remaining barriers to an effective industry-led solution.

Following the Autumn Budget, we are continuing to support Arts Council England’s Supporting Grassroots Music Fund, which provides grants, including to music venues and festivals.
